First off, let's understand what a heavy - duty CNC vertical milling machine is. It's a powerful piece of equipment that's built to handle large and tough jobs. With its vertical spindle orientation, it can perform various milling operations like face milling, end milling, and drilling on a wide range of materials. It's known for its high torque, rigid construction, and the ability to handle heavy cuts.

Now, when it comes to high - precision gear machining, there are a few key factors to consider. Precision gears require tight tolerances, smooth surfaces, and accurate tooth profiles. The manufacturing process usually involves cutting, grinding, and finishing operations to achieve the desired specifications.

One of the main advantages of using a heavy - duty CNC vertical milling machine for gear machining is its rigidity. A High Rigidity Cnc Milling Machine provides a stable platform during the machining process. This stability is crucial when you're dealing with high - precision work. It helps to minimize vibrations, which can otherwise lead to inaccuracies in the gear's tooth profile and surface finish.

The CNC control system in these machines is another big plus. It allows for precise control of the cutting tools, enabling you to program complex gear geometries with ease. You can specify the depth of cut, feed rate, and spindle speed, all of which are essential for achieving the right level of precision. For example, if you're machining a helical gear, the CNC system can accurately control the helix angle and pitch, ensuring that the gear meets the required standards.

However, there are also some challenges. High - precision gear machining often demands extremely fine surface finishes. While a heavy - duty CNC vertical milling machine can get you close, it might not always achieve the ultra - smooth surfaces that some high - end gears require. In such cases, additional finishing operations like grinding or honing might be necessary.

Another aspect to consider is the cutting tools. Milling Machine Tools play a crucial role in the quality of the machined gears. You need to choose the right type of tool, with the appropriate geometry and coating, to ensure efficient cutting and long tool life. For gear machining, special gear - cutting tools such as hob cutters or gear shapers might be required.

Let's talk about the size and complexity of the gears. Heavy - duty CNC vertical milling machines are great for medium to large - sized gears. They can handle the weight and size of these gears without compromising on the machining accuracy. But when it comes to very small and highly complex gears, a Small Shop Cnc Milling Machine might be a better option. Smaller machines offer more flexibility and precision for intricate work.

Now, let's take a look at some real - world examples. Many manufacturers in the automotive and aerospace industries use heavy - duty CNC vertical milling machines for gear production. In the automotive sector, gears for transmissions and differentials need to be highly precise to ensure smooth operation and long - term durability. These machines can produce gears that meet the strict quality standards of the industry.

In the aerospace industry, where safety is of utmost importance, precision gears are critical for the proper functioning of aircraft components. Heavy - duty CNC vertical milling machines can be used to machine gears for flight control systems, landing gear mechanisms, and engine components. The ability to produce gears with high accuracy and reliability makes these machines a valuable asset in these industries.
